Asphalt Shingles Explanation

Asphalt shingles are considered as one of the most common roofing materials in residential construction. Known for their affordability and ease of installation, they serve homeowners in search of cost-effective solutions. Available in a selection of colors and styles, asphalt shingles boost the aesthetic appeal of many homes. Their durability against weather elements is impressive, with a lifespan typically ranging from 15 to 30 years. However, they may be less effective in severe weather, such as high winds or heavy snowfall. Additionally, while they offer adequate insulation, they are not as energy-efficient as some other materials. Overall, asphalt shingles remain a reliable choice for homeowners emphasizing budget, style, and adequate protection for their residences.

Metal Roofing Advantages

Metal roofing offers a selection of benefits that can assist homeowners pursuing longevity and strength. This roofing material is noted for its exceptional resistance to harsh weather conditions, including high winds, hail, and heavy snow. Also, metal roofs have a lifespan of 40 to 70 years, substantially outlasting traditional materials like asphalt shingles. They are also energy-efficient, bouncing back solar radiant heat and reducing cooling costs in warmer months. Metal roofing is low-maintenance, requiring minimal upkeep compared to other options. In addition, it is environmentally friendly, often made from recycled materials and fully recyclable at the end of its life. For homeowners prioritizing both safeguarding and visual charm, metal roofing is an excellent choice.

How much time Does a Typical Roofing Job Take to Complete?

A routine roofing project normally requires from one to three weeks for finishing. Factors determining the length include the assignment's size, weather conditions, and the complexity of the roof design being applied or repaired.

Which Varieties of Roofing Materials Offer the Greatest Energy Saving Benefits?

Metal, slate, and clay tiles are included among the most economical roofing solutions. These options reflect solar rays, reduce thermal gain, and help achieve lower energy costs, making them ideal options for advancing home energy efficiency.

How Can I keep My Roof in good condition After Installation?

Preserving a roof following installation necessitates frequent inspections, expedient maintenance, and consistent cleaning. Clearing debris, examining for water intrusion, and supporting adequate water movement can considerably extend the roof's longevity and function.

What can I take action if I identify a leak subsequent to repair work?

Upon detecting a leak after work, one should immediately contact the roofing contractor to evaluate the situation. Record the leak's location and extent, ensuring that all correspondence and observations are carefully documented for future use.
